On January 12 2012 02:04 Yonnua wrote:
Show nested quote +
On January 12 2012 01:51 Bleak wrote:
Does anyone think that the addition of Shredders and Battle Hellions could make TvP mech viable? Shredders could give map control for counter attacks and battle hellions would protect the tanks from mass chargelots. On paper it sounds quite good to me. Any opinions?


I don't see shredders regularly getting through the shields on protoss units. A few stalkers or zealots could probably punch through one before losing too much hull health. On the other hand, they could be a good way to deal with DTs without detection or using scans.


I imagine they'd be good in larger main maps like lost temple for putting on the edge of your base to prevent warp prism drop/warp in on the edges of the base, with a little support. i can imagine that they'd tear through a toss unit pretty quick as it was warping in. or for useful line of sight areas like the trees next to the natural on xel'naga caverns

On January 12 2012 03:32 Bleak wrote:
Show nested quote +
On January 12 2012 02:04 Yonnua wrote:
On January 12 2012 01:51 Bleak wrote:
Does anyone think that the addition of Shredders and Battle Hellions could make TvP mech viable? Shredders could give map control for counter attacks and battle hellions would protect the tanks from mass chargelots. On paper it sounds quite good to me. Any opinions?


I don't see shredders regularly getting through the shields on protoss units. A few stalkers or zealots could probably punch through one before losing too much hull health. On the other hand, they could be a good way to deal with DTs without detection or using scans.


But they would surely help while slowpushing with a mech army. 3-4 well positioned shredders in front, battle hellions behind and tanks in the back. It really seems like it could work. If anything, they would still force Protoss back.


I like this idea. Seems to me that a good option will be to reposition and slow push with shredders, alternating them with tanks doing the same. It'd slow down the already super-slow slow push considerably but it would also make Protoss players very unwilling to engage straight up. They'll have to do fun, creative things like using void rays or phoenix (are shredders light?) to pick off shredders while they move forward, forcing marines up into the shredder fields to ward them off, deactivating the shredders and providing a window for the Protoss army to attack.

Personally, I'm excited :D And I don't even play Protoss or Terran!
